Happy 1st December! Advent begins today, the season of bad music, mulled wine and excessive food consumption is almost upon us! Here’s some suggestions from me as to what to do before it arrives!
1. If you haven’t already done so, buy / make an advent calendar, preferably with chocolate in it!
2. Decorate your house / room – even if you just put a few shiny baubles, or a bit of tinsel, every little helps!
3. Buy or otherwise choose your Xmas party outfit! Even if you’re having a quiet one this year and not attending any, pick something beautiful yet comfortable to wear on the day itself to help it feel that little bit more festive!
4. If you’re a student or self-employed, finish all your assignments / tasks in good time so that you can take a real break and enjoy the Xmas break without thinking about all you have to do when you start working again!
5. A very practical one now, prepare a list of all the things you still need to buy / prepare - this includes household essentials, you really don’t want to run out of toilet roll halfway through Xmas day when there are no shops open!
6. Visit your local German Christmas Market at least once, they’re great fun and a brilliant way to get into the “festive spirit” (alcoholic or otherwise!). I’m going to the Nottingham one tomorrow!
7. Unless you reallylove them, don’t listen to any Xmas songs unless you have to, otherwise you’ll be totally sick of them by around the 10th!
8. If you’re a blogger, write those scheduled posts as early as possible so you don’t have loads to do when you’re panicking about your last-minute shopping!
9. Go out specifically to look at the lights, and take photos.
10. Try and find out when your local supermarkets are having Xmas food tastings, and arrange your grocery shopping trips to coincide with them.
11. Get together with friends you may not see over Xmas itself for a pre-seasonal drink and catch-up.
12. Buy at least one ridiculous Xmas-themed accessory – snowflake earrings, a flashing Santa badge, even simply a piece of tinsel to wear as a belt, then wear it to work!
